📌  相关文章
📜  如何在 html 中包含破折号(1)

📅  最后修改于: 2023-12-03 14:52:18.927000             🧑  作者: Mango

如何在 HTML 中包含破折号

在HTML中,可以使用实体字符(entity character)的方式来包含破折号(dash)。破折号实体字符的代码是 —

实体字符的使用方法

在HTML中,可以使用实体字符来代替一些特殊字符或无法直接输入的字符。下面通过一些示例来演示如何在HTML中使用破折号实体字符。

直接使用实体字符

可以直接在HTML代码中使用实体字符 — 来表示破折号。例如:

<p>这是一段带有破折号的文本&mdash;这是一个示例。</p>

该段落将在显示时包含一个破折号,效果如下:

这是一段带有破折号的文本—这是一个示例。

使用实体字符的名称

除了使用 &mdash; 的代码表示破折号实体字符外,还可以使用实体字符的名称 &mdash;。例如:

<p>这是一段带有破折号的文本&amp;mdash;这是一个示例。</p>

在HTML代码中,需要使用 &amp; 来表示 & 符号本身,以避免与实体字符的开始和结束标记产生混淆。该段落将在显示时包含一个破折号,效果与直接使用实体字符相同。

使用CSS伪元素

还可以使用CSS的伪元素 ::after::before 来插入破折号。例如:

<p>这是一段带有破折号的文本<span class="dash"></span>这是一个示例。</p>

<style>
.dash::after {
   content: "\2014";
}
</style>

通过为破折号创建一个 ::after 伪元素,并设置其 content 属性为破折号的Unicode值 \2014,可以在显示时将破折号插入到文本中间。效果如下:

这是一段带有破折号的文本这是一个示例。

总结

在HTML中包含破折号有多种方式:直接使用实体字符 &mdash;,使用实体字符的名称 &mdash;,以及使用CSS伪元素。根据需求选择合适的方法即可实现在HTML文档中包含破折号的效果。

注意:以上代码片段中的HTML代码为示例代码,实际在使用时需要根据具体情况进行调整和修改。